For the 2026 school year, there are 3 public schools serving 1,468 students in Dove Schools Of Tulsa Charter. This district's average testing ranking is 6/10, which is in the top 50% of public schools in Oklahoma.
Public Schools in Dove Schools Of Tulsa Charter have an average math proficiency score of 32% (versus the Oklahoma public school average of 25%), and reading proficiency score of 22% (versus the 28%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 86%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Oklahoma public school average of 57% (majority Hispanic).

Dove Schools Of Tulsa Charter, which is ranked within the top 50% of all 532 school districts in Oklahoma (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data) for the 2022-2023 school year.
The school district's graduation rate of 80-89% has decreased from 90% over five school years.

District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$7,098 in this school district is less than the state median of $11,355. The school district revenue/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$6,230 is less than the state median of $11,328. The school district spending/student has declined by 23% over four school years.
